First off, let’s talk about the basics of H1Z1 skins. These are virtual items that you can use to customize your weapons, vehicles, and character in the game. They come in all sorts of designs and colors, and some of them are pretty rare and valuable.

If you’re looking to sell your H1Z1 skins, then you need to find a marketplace that’s legit and trustworthy. There are plenty of websites out there that claim to buy and sell skins, but you gotta be careful not to get scammed or ripped off.

One of the best places to sell your H1Z1 skins is on the Steam community market. This is an official marketplace that’s run by Valve, the company that makes H1Z1. To sell on the market, you first need to set up a Steam account and enable trading. Then, you can list your skins for sale at a price that you’re happy with.

Another option is to sell your skins on third-party marketplaces like OPSkins or Bitskins. These sites allow you to trade skins for real money, and they have a wide range of buyers and sellers. However, you need to be careful when using third-party sites, as some of them can be sketchy or unreliable.

When listing your skins for sale, make sure to do your research and check the prices of similar skins on the market. You don’t want to overprice your skins and turn away potential buyers, but you also don’t want to sell them for too cheap and lose out on profits.

One thing to keep in mind is that H1Z1 skins can be subject to fluctuations in price due to supply and demand. Some skins may be more popular at certain times or in certain regions, so it’s important to stay up-to-date on the market trends and adjust your prices accordingly.
